JPMorgan's JPM Coin on Coinbase Base: A Catalyst for Institutional DeFi Adoption


Strategic Move: JPM Coin on Base
JPMorgan's JPM Coin, first introduced in 2019, has evolved from a niche experiment to a cornerstone of institutional-grade tokenized finance. The November 2025 rollout on Base marks a strategic leap forward. Unlike traditional stablecoins, JPM Coin represents a direct claim on bank-held funds, with each token backed by U.S. dollars in segregated accounts at JPMorgan, according to a Coinotag article. This design eliminates the volatility risks associated with algorithmic stablecoins while offering yield-bearing capabilities-a feature absent in most fiat-pegged tokens.
The choice of Base as the deployment platform is equally significant. As an L2 network, Base inherits Ethereum's security while slashing transaction costs and accelerating settlement times. For institutional clients, this means frictionless cross-border transfers and real-time liquidity management, bypassing the intermediaries and delays of traditional banking systems, according to the Coinpaprika report. JPMorgan's blockchain division, Kinexys, has already tested the system in a June 2025 pilot with partners like B2C2, CoinbaseCOIN--, and Mastercard, demonstrating its viability for high-value, time-sensitive transactions, as reported in the Coinpaprika report.
Broader Institutional Adoption: A Tipping Point
JPMorgan's move is not an isolated event but part of a larger trend. Major banks, including BNY Mellon, Barclays, and HSBC, are now actively exploring tokenized deposit solutions to enhance cross-border payment efficiency and reduce settlement risks, according to the Coinpaprika report. The appeal lies in L2 networks' ability to combine Ethereum's composability with lower fees and faster finality-critical for institutions wary of blockchain's historical scalability limitations.
The yield-bearing nature of JPM Coin further distinguishes it. By offering interest directly to holders, JPMorgan has created a product that aligns with institutional demand for liquidity optimization. This innovation mirrors efforts by Citigroup and Deutsche Bank to integrate blockchain into their treasury services, suggesting a paradigm shift in how banks view tokenization as a revenue-generating tool, according to a BeInCrypto analysis.
Impact on DeFi: Bridging the Gap
The implications for DeFi are profound. JPMorgan's deployment on Base-a network designed to support both DeFi-native services and regulated tokens-has already spurred increased transaction volumes. From 2023 to 2025, DeFi platforms witnessed a 40% year-over-year surge in institutional activity, with tokenized USD deposits accounting for a growing share of collateral and liquidity pools, according to the BeInCrypto analysis.
This trend is accelerating as interoperability experiments, such as JPMorgan's collaboration with Singapore's DBS, demonstrate cross-network compatibility. By enabling tokenized deposits to flow seamlessly between TradFi and DeFi ecosystems, these initiatives are dismantling the silos that once separated them. For investors, this signals a maturing market where institutional-grade security and DeFi's innovation coexist.
